Chinese Premier Li Keqiang on Thursday met with the United Arab Emirates (UAE) Vice President and Prime Minister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, who is in Beijing to attend the Second Belt and Road Forum for International Cooperation.

Noting that China and the UAE are each other's important cooperation partners, the bilateral relations have maintained sound and steady development since the establishment of diplomatic ties 35 years ago, Li said.

The premier noted that China has huge market potential and welcomes the UAE to expand its investment in the country.

China is ready to work with the UAE to give full play to their respective advantages, strengthen all-round friendly cooperation, increase communication and coordination in international and regional affairs, and achieve common development, Li said.

The UAE attaches importance to developing relations with China, and the cooperation between the two countries has gained a strong momentum, said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um.

The UAE firmly adheres to the one-China policy, supports the Belt and Road Initiative, and looks forward to consolidating strategic relations with China, he said.
